RESOLUTION NO. 2004- 003 <br />1. The foregoing recitals are affirmed and ratified in their entirety. <br />2. The special assessments imposed for the Assessment Project against the specially <br />benefited properties in the Assessment Area shown on the assessment roll attached hereto <br />as Exhibit A are hereby confirmed and approved, and shall remain legal, valid, and binding <br />first liens against the specially benefited properties shown on Exhibit "A" until paid in full. <br />The special assessments for the Assessment Project shall constitute a lien against the <br />specially assessed property in the Assessment Area equal in rank and dignity with the liens <br />of all state, county, district or municipal taxes, and other non -ad valorem assessments. <br />Except as otherwise provided by law, such special assessment lien shall be superior in <br />dignity to all other liens, titles and claims, until paid. The special assessment lien shall be <br />deemed perfected upon adoption by the. Board of this Resolution and recordation of this <br />Resolution in the Official Records of the County maintained by the Clerk of Indian River <br />County. Such recordation shall constitute prima facie evidence of the validity of the special <br />assessments imposed for the Assessment Project in the Assessment Area. <br />3. The Board hereby finds and determines that the special assessments imposed in <br />accordance with this Resolution and Resolution No. 2003-157 provide an equitable method <br />of funding the construction of the Assessment Project by fairly and reasonably allocating the <br />cost to specially benefited property, based upon the square footage attributable to each <br />parcel of property in the manner described in Resolution 2003-157.
